当前位置:主页 > 科技论文 > 软件论文 >

基于云平台的在线学习系统设计与实现

发布时间:2023-05-20 01:45
  云计算技术以及大数据技术的发展,使得在线学习的实施具有了更多的条件,其具有资源更新便捷、实时沟通方便等优势,具有较高的稳定性与灵活度,这都为在线学习平台的开发奠定了较好的基础。本系统的目标旨在结合先进的数字资源来为不同类型的学习者提供便捷的学习通道,并为员工之间的沟通以及学习效果测评等提供便利,确保学习效果能够得到改善。本文首先分析了基于云计算的企业在线学习系统背景与意义,根据其发展状况分析了系统相关的开发技术、架构方式等。然后根据系统的需求构建了功能模块,设计与实现了基于云计算企业在线学习系统,能够为不同类型的课程学习者提供个性化的沟通和学习服务。本文的研究内容具体可以分为如下几个方面:(1)基于云计算企业在线学习系统的实现背景以及发展状况等进行分析与总结,介绍了本系统开发的AJAX异步刷新技术、Google云计算关键技术、Google App Engine等关键技术。(2)基于云计算企业在线学习系统的相关流程进行了需求分析,明确了系统需要实现的功能;通过时序图的方式对系统的业务流程进行了描述;设计并完成了系统的用例图;最后通过UML模型深入的分析了系统。(3)本文基于B/S(浏览器...

【文章页数】:65 页

【学位级别】:硕士

【文章目录】:
摘要
abstract
第一章 绪论
    1.1 研究背景及意义
    1.2 研究现状
        1.2.1 在线学习的概念与特点
        1.2.2 在线学习的发展现状
    1.3 开发环境介绍
    1.4 论文章节安排
第二章 系统相关技术
    2.1 MVC开发模式
    2.2 AJAX异步刷新技术
    2.3 Google云计算关键技术
        2.3.1 分布式文件系统(GFS)
        2.3.2 分布式计算编程模型(MapReduce)
        2.3.3 分布式数据存储系统(Big table)
    2.4 Google App Engine
    2.5 本章小结
第三章 云计算在线学习系统需求分析
    3.1 系统的功能需求分析
        3.1.1 平台的实现目标
        3.1.2 平台的功能需求
    3.2 系统非功能性需求分析
    3.3 系统性能需求分析
    3.4 云计算在线学习平台的服务模式分析
        3.4.1 云计算的服务模式
        3.4.2 云计算在线学习平台的服务模式
    3.5 本章小结
第四章 系统设计
    4.1 系统目标
    4.2 云计算在线学习平台的结构
    4.3 云计算在线学习平台功能模块设计
        4.3.1 用户管理模块设计
        4.3.2 资源管理模块设计
        4.3.3 公共信息模块设计
        4.3.4 浏览课程详细设计与实现
        4.3.5 分享课程设计与实现
        4.3.6 互动交流模块设计
        4.3.7 课程推荐模块
    4.4 本章小结
第五章 系统详细设计与实现
    5.1 主要功能模块实现
        5.1.1 用户管理模块
        5.1.2 资源管理模块
        5.1.3 课程分享
        5.1.4 公共信息模块
        5.1.5 互动交流模块
    5.2 主要功能实现效果图
    5.3 本章小结
第六章 系统测试
    6.1 系统测试目标
    6.2 系统功能测试
    6.3 系统非功能性测试
    6.4 本章小结
第七章 结论
    7.1 总结
    7.2 展望
参考文献
附录A
个人简历 在读期间发表的学术论文
致谢



本文编号:3820296

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/ruanjiangongchenglunwen/3820296.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户d7fae***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com